How can I suppress the second OWA 2007 login prompt?

Windows server 2003 STD SP2 terminal services
Exchange 2007 SP2 Enterprise
IIS 6
Internet Explorer 8
Outlook 2003
OWA 2007 single sign-on

OWA single sign-on worked correctly until Exchange SP2 was applied (skipped
SP1). Now OWA 2007 users are presented with an OWA login prompt in IE8 and
Firefox 3.5. Clicking the login command button without entering user
credentials lets the user past the prompt and opens OWA with the users
account.

Troubleshooting: Mostly steps suggested on EE and Google searches.
IE8: Set user authentication to use current user name and password
IE8: Deleted browsing history and cookies, set to delete browsing history
on exit
IE8: set default web page to blank to see if GPO is providing URL or IIS
Group Policy: URL forced from default domain policy = http://exchange/owa
IE8: opens with
http://exchange/owa/auth/logon.aspx?replaceCurrent=1&url=http%3a%2f%fexchange%2fowa%2f
Exchange Server: Disabled FBA and set to windows authentication
Works correctly for domain admin, but everyone else is prompted twice
Affects all users not an isolated group
All systems are running in VMWARE ESX 3.5 SP4

Hm. Unfortunately, nearly all the log entries in that last post were for the
BB, then. Try logging into OWA again (when it's quiet, so there are fewer
log entries). Verify that you see two logons, wait a few minutes (so the
server can flush the entries), and then have another look at the log file.
Use the CS (client to server) IP address to eliminate entries that aren't
your own (you can even do this in Excel), and look for the 401s.
